There is no way Herschel was better than Dickerson as a Senior-not even close. Walker averaged about 5.0 yards a carry while Dickerson averaged 7 yards per carry. Craig James is the only thing that kept Dickerson from winning the Heisman because Dickerson took only about 45% of the snaps. The First year in the NFL Dickerson sets an NFL Rookie rushing record that still stands. He was simply the best running back in football from 1980-1986. No one can touch his numbers during his prime.
